The amount of time it takes for glue in an assembly to dry or cure sufficiently for the clamps to be removed. Set time varies depending on temperature, glue type, and humidity. Use the following times as rough guidelines:
  • Aliphatic resin (yellow) -- 30-60 min.
  • Polyvinyl acetate (white) -- 30-65 min.
  • Water-resistant (yellow) -- 60 min.
  • Polyurethane -- 60 min.
  • Epoxy -- Varies by type
  • Liquid hide glue -- 60 min.


Note: Several manufacturers offer quick-set glues that achieve high tack (stickiness) just after application. Use these for assembling moldings and other difficult-to-clamp projects requiring hurry-up adhesion.
